AC Schnitzer 4 Series Coupe
55
COMMENTS

AC Schnitzer has released initial info on its tuning program for the 4 Series Coupe.

Starting with the engine, the AC Schnitzer tune for the 435i bumps its power up to 360 HP (265 kW), the 428i up to 294 HP (216 kW) and the 420d up to 218 HP (160 kW). To add to the visceral experience, a sports exhaust system is available.

For handling, they offer a height adjustable 'racing suspension,' as well as a lowering sprint kit which will lower the F32 by approximately 25mm (0.98 in).

And as usual, a host of of AC Schnitzer 18-20" wheels and interior bits are also available.

Aero kit parts will be announced later. What we're seeing here is a 4 Series with M Sport Package, lower springs, ACS wheels and ACS sport exhaust.
